    Got the very same problem, cygrunsrv.exe & sshd.exe from
    v3.8.1p1-1 hogging the CPU after system startup.

    After putting in \OpenSSH\bin\ the libraries cygintl-2.dll and
    cygintl-3.dll missing in the distribution package to work
    aorund bug #1286157, this problem has also gone away. I
    have restarted that system several times since then, and the
    services have had a clean start every time.

    So the absence of cygintl-2 & cygintl-3 libraries seems to be
    the cause for this misbehaviour.
